Narvel
Narvel is a given name. People with the name include:Narvel Blackstock, former husband of Reba McEntire Narvel J. Crawford, former member of the North Carolina House of Representatives. Narvel Felts, American country music singer

The Story of Narvel
American parents first put Narvel on the record books as a baby boy name in 1916, with 5 registered babies. Its peak popularity came in 1927, when 10 Narvels were born — ranking #2,703 that year. The 1920s were its strongest decade, accounting for roughly 39% of all recorded Narvels. Its most recent appearance in the national data came in 1964 (6 births); the name has since faded from the published rankings. In total, more than 132 Narvels have been born in the U.S. since records began in 1880, spanning the 1910s through the 2020s.
